The transmission in a 2009 Dodge Ram 1500 depends on the engine. In general, models with the 5.7L Hemi or the 4.7L V8 use a 5-speed automatic, while the 3.7L V6 uses a 4-speed automatic.
The 2009 Ram 1500 was offered with three engines: a 3.7-liter V6, a 4.7-liter V8, and a 5.7-liter Hemi V8. The transmissions paired with these engines varied by configuration, affecting performance and efficiency. Below is a practical guide to the typical gearboxes found in that model year.
Engine-transmission pairings
Because transmissions can vary by trim level and production date, here is a general guide to the most common configurations for the 2009 Ram 1500.
- 3.7L V6 engine — 4-speed automatic transmission
- 4.7L V8 engine — 5-speed automatic transmission
- 5.7L Hemi V8 engine — 5-speed automatic transmission
These pairings reflect the typical factory configurations for the 2009 Ram 1500. Individual trucks may vary based on options, regional specifications, or subsequent owner modifications. If you need the exact transmission for a specific vehicle, refer to the VIN, the window sticker, or the owner's manual.
How to verify your vehicle's transmission
To confirm the exact transmission in a given 2009 Ram 1500, use one or more of the following: check the vehicle identification number (VIN) and build sheet, look at the original window sticker, or inspect the transmission identification on the transmission pan or dipstick code. A dealer or independent shop can also decode the VIN for the precise transmission family and gear count.
